PLEASE LET'S KEEP THIS CIVIL! I KNOW THIS IS A TOUCHY SUBJECT BUT WOULD LIKE TO HEAR EVERYONE'S VIEWS AND OPINIONS ON THIS SUBJECT, SINCE IT EFFECTS OUR BREED NEW LAWS ARE TRYING TO PREVENT EAR CROPPING (AND TAIL DOCKING- BUT DOESN'T EFFECT OUR BREED.).
Here's my position: I feel ear cropping should be a personal choice with all facts both pros and cons known by the individual planning to crop. I personaly feel that today's Danes are cropped soley for cosmetic purposes only. Yes, at one time they were cropped for a purpose (hunting) but they were cropped like today's "pitbull crop"! They took the ear way down for the safty of the animal. Today's crop is done soley for the "look" of the Dane and no other reason. | |

In Germany it is illegal to "mutilate" your dog. Words like that certainly put a different slant on it. I wish judges weren't prejudiced in favor of cropped ears--since the standard says natural is allowed, a good judge should be able to look past the ears and see the entire dog. I'm a little sensitive since folks have asked that question (Are his ears done?) and expressed disappointment before they even seen my pup. I guess just getting out there in the ring will be the biggest help in making it seem more natural and familiar... Roseann | |
